Mahmoud Mohamed
I'm a software engineer specializing in modern web development and creating exceptional user experiences.
Driven Front-End Developer with strong experience building responsive, high-performance web applications using modern technologies like React.js and Next.js. Adept at creating intuitive user interfaces, collaborating in agile teams, and delivering scalable solutions. Known for being detail-oriented, adaptable, and committed to continuous learning and user-centric design.
Work Experience
Frontend React.js Next.js
Madmon.ai
Cairo, Egypt
Built a modern website and interactive dashboard using Next.js, React.js, and TypeScript. Used MUI, ShadCN, Tailwind CSS, and React Query to create responsive and consistent UIs. Focused on performance optimization, accessibility, and cross-device responsiveness. Collaborated with cross-functional teams to deliver high-quality, scalable solutions.
- •Built a modern website and interactive dashboard using Next.js, React.js, and TypeScript.
- •Used MUI, ShadCN, Tailwind CSS, and React Query to create responsive and consistent UIs.
- •Focused on performance optimization, accessibility, and cross-device responsiveness.
- •Collaborated with cross-functional teams to deliver high-quality, scalable solutions.
Kalbonyan Elmarsos Internship
Kalbonyan Elmarsos
Remote
200+ hours of hands-on training in full-stack development and cloud deployment. Built projects using React.js, Node.js, HTML/CSS, and JavaScript. Practiced Git/GitHub, API integration, and responsive UI design. Learned core CS topics: OOP, algorithms, data structures, design patterns, and databases. Deployed apps using AWS and Serverless Stack.
- •200+ hours of hands-on training in full-stack development and cloud deployment.
- •Built projects using React.js, Node.js, HTML/CSS, and JavaScript.
- •Practiced Git/GitHub, API integration, and responsive UI design.
- •Learned core CS topics: OOP, algorithms, data structures, design patterns, and databases.
- •Deployed apps using AWS and Serverless Stack.
Projects
ZeroGPT
Built a full-stack SaaS platform that detects AI-generated text in real time using advanced analysis algorithms. Implemented Google OAuth authentication, role-based access control, and subscription billing with Stripe. Designed developer API with key management, rate limiting, and integration documentation for third-party apps. Delivered multilingual support (8+ languages) with Next.js internationalization and responsive UI using Tailwind CSS.
Tech Stack: Next.js 15, React 19, TypeScript, Prisma ORM, MySQL, Stripe API, Radix UI, JWT, Vitest
Reparo
Reparo.dev is an all-in-one, DNS-only performance optimization platform that boosts PageSpeed Insights and GTmetrix scores without requiring plugins or SDKs. It enhances site speed across desktop and mobile via advanced optimization of images, HTML, servers, and third-party assets. With deep technical SEO support, quality-assured testing, and control over HTML tweaks, it ensures smoother workflows and better UX.
Galley System
Developed a bilingual (Arabic/English) CMS with real-time analytics, content management, and secure role-based access. Built advanced admin dashboard with CRUD operations, Excel import/export, image uploads, and user management. Designed scalable architecture with Appwrite, automated migration scripts, cloud storage integration, and SEO support.
Tech Stack: Next.js 15, React 19, TypeScript, Appwrite, Tailwind CSS, Radix UI, next-intl, Prisma ORM, MySQL
EduBrain
Built AI-driven platform providing instant homework assistance across 30+ subjects using OpenAI GPT-4. Integrated Stripe subscription system with secure checkout, webhook processing, and tiered access control. Implemented JWT authentication, bcrypt password hashing, email verification, and 100% test coverage with Vitest. Designed responsive, multilingual UI with Tailwind CSS, Radix UI, React Query, and PDF export functionality.
Tech Stack: Next.js 15, React 19, TypeScript, Prisma ORM, MySQL, OpenAI API, Stripe, Nodemailer, Vitest